Rejected petition Repeal the The Bread and Flour (Amendment) (England) Regulations 2024

The Bread and Flour (Amendment) (England) Regulations 2024 will require flour millers to fortify non-wholemeal wheat flour with folic acid.
The people who have signed this petition demand that this act is repealed, or at the very least a referendum is held so the public may choose for themselves.

More details

According to the gov.uk announcement in November 2024, the intention is to prevent 200 cases of debilitating brain and spine defects in babies every year.
This represents less than 0.03 percent of the number of babies born each year and would rely upon the pregnant mother's of those babies affected eating non-wholemeal bread as part of their regular diet.
Removing all choice from the entire UK population who choose to eat non-wholemeal wheat products is utterly ridiculous and a draconian move.
